背景:
    调度、线程、软件定时器、sortlink、percpu、异常、workqueue模块相互耦合,存在很多不属于本模块的实现,
导致这几个模块间依赖混乱、且到处引用其它模块的内部成员。

方案描述:
    解决上述依赖混乱的问题,为后续调度框架打基础,优化后依赖关系:

                                                              | ---> los_swtmr_pri.h --> workqueue
los_sortlink_pri.h: ---> los_sched_pri.h --> los_task_pri.h -->
   作为基础算法                                               | ---> ipc
(现在为双向链表),
做到功能最小化,
便于后续其它算法替换

调度框架大体方案描述:

1.cpu run queue ----> 任务延时队列

                                         |---- 调度队列
                   |----  EDF        --->
                   |                     |---- 方法(Delay、Suspend、Resume、EntReadyQue、Exit等)
                   |
                   |                     |---- 调度队列
2.task ---> 调度策略----> SCHED_RR   --->
                   |                     |---- 方法(Delay、Suspend、Resume、EntReadyQue、Exit等)
                   |
                   |                     |---- 调度队列
                   |----> SCHED_IDLE --->
                                         |---- 方法(Delay、Suspend、Resume、EntReadyQue、Exit等)

#ifndef _LOS_SWTMR_PRI_H
#define _LOS_SWTMR_PRI_H
#include "los_swtmr.h"
#include "los_spinlock.h"
#include "los_sched_pri.h"
#ifdef LOSCFG_SECURITY_VID
#include "vid_api.h"
#else
#define MAX_INVALID_TIMER_VID OS_SWTMR_MAX_TIMERID
#endif
#ifdef __cplusplus
#if __cplusplus
extern "C" {
#endif /* __cplusplus */
#endif /* __cplusplus */
/**
* @ingroup los_swtmr_pri
* Software timer state
*/
enum SwtmrState {
OS_SWTMR_STATUS_UNUSED, /**< The software timer is not used. */
OS_SWTMR_STATUS_CREATED, /**< The software timer is created. */
OS_SWTMR_STATUS_TICKING /**< The software timer is timing. */
};
/**
* @ingroup los_swtmr_pri
* Structure of the callback function that handles software timer timeout
*/
typedef struct {
SWTMR_PROC_FUNC handler; /**< Callback function that handles software timer timeout */
UINTPTR arg; /**< Parameter passed in when the callback function
that handles software timer timeout is called */
} SwtmrHandlerItem;
/**
* @ingroup los_swtmr_pri
* Type of the pointer to the structure of the callback function that handles software timer timeout
*/
typedef SwtmrHandlerItem *SwtmrHandlerItemPtr;
extern SWTMR_CTRL_S *g_swtmrCBArray;
#define OS_SWT_FROM_SID(swtmrID) ((SWTMR_CTRL_S *)g_swtmrCBArray + ((swtmrID) % LOSCFG_BASE_CORE_SWTMR_LIMIT))
/**
* @ingroup los_swtmr_pri
* @brief Scan a software timer.
*
* @par Description:
* <ul>
* <li>This API is used to scan a software timer when a Tick interrupt occurs and determine whether
* the software timer expires.</li>
* </ul>
* @attention
* <ul>
* <li>None.</li>
* </ul>
*
* @param None.
*
* @retval None.
* @par Dependency:
* <ul><li>los_swtmr_pri.h: the header file that contains the API declaration.</li></ul>
* @see LOS_SwtmrStop
*/
extern BOOL OsIsSwtmrTask(const LosTaskCB *taskCB);
extern VOID OsSwtmrRestart(UINT64 startTime, SortLinkList *sortList);
extern VOID OsSwtmrWake(SchedRunQue *rq, UINT64 currTime, SortLinkList *sortList);
extern UINT32 OsSwtmrInit(VOID);
extern VOID OsSwtmrRecycle(UINT32 processID);
extern BOOL OsSwtmrWorkQueueFind(SCHED_TL_FIND_FUNC checkFunc, UINTPTR arg);
extern SPIN_LOCK_S g_swtmrSpin;
#ifdef __cplusplus
#if __cplusplus
}
#endif /* __cplusplus */
#endif /* __cplusplus */
#endif /* _LOS_SWTMR_PRI_H */
